Differential Diagnosis For Xray/Parietal bossing/Skull
- Infectious Disorders (Specific Agent)
Rubella, congenital
Rubella, Maternal Acquired
Syphilis, congenital
Syphilis, congenital, late- Infected organ, Abscesses
Osteomyelitis, frontal bone- Metabolic, Storage Disorders
Mucopolysaccharidoses
Hurler's mucopolysaccharidosis syndrome
Fucosidosis (Anderson-Fabry)
Gangliosidosis, generalized (GM1)- Deficiency Disorders
Rickets (vitamin D deficiency)
Rickets/X-linked hypophosphatemic- Congenital, Developmental Disorders
Craniosynostosis
Cerebral gigantism of childhood (Sotos)
Craniofacial dysostosis/Crouzon
Dysplasia, craniometaphyseal
Dysplasia, frontometaphyseal
Hallermann-Streiff-Francois syndrome
Progeria
Progeria of child (Hutchinson-Gilford)
Silver-Russell syndrome- Hereditary, Familial, Genetic Disorders
Osteopetrosis (Albers-Schonberg)
Basal cell nevus syndrome (Gorlin)
Neonatal Progeria Familial (Wiedemann)
Dolichospondylic dysplasia
Otopalatodigital syndrome
Familial Vitamin D dependent Rickets- Vegetative, Autonomic, Endocrine Disorders
Acromegaly (Gigantism)
Gigantism, pituitary- Reference to Organ System
Paget's disease (osteitis deformans)
Pagets disease, juvenile- Synonyms
